Comprehending Double Glazing
Double glazing is a window system that includes 2 panes of glass separated by a layer of air or gas. This air or gas serves as an insulating barrier, minimizing heat loss in the winter season and heat gain in the summer season. The innovation has actually been around for years but has seen substantial developments recently, making it more effective and economical.
Advantages of Double Glazing in Luton
-
Energy Efficiency
- Reduced Heat Loss: Double glazing can substantially minimize heat loss through windows, which are typically the weakest point in a home's insulation. This can lead to lower heating expenses and a more comfy living environment.
- Lower Energy Bills: By enhancing the thermal efficiency of a home, double glazing can help in reducing the requirement for cooling and heating, resulting in lower energy bills.
-
Sound Reduction
- Quieter Home: The insulating layer in between the two panes of glass assists to moisten external sound, making your home a quieter and more serene location to live. This is particularly useful for homes in busy areas or near airports.
-
Increased Property Value
- Higher Resale Value: Installing double glazing can increase the worth of your property, making it a sound financial investment for the future. Possible purchasers are often going to pay more for a home with energy-efficient features.
-
Reduced Condensation
- Less Moisture: Double glazing can help in reducing condensation on windows, which can lead to mold and mildew growth. This not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of your home however also contributes to a healthier living environment.
-
Enhanced Security
- Stronger Windows: Double-glazed windows are typically more safe and secure than single-glazed windows. The extra pane of glass and the secure locking systems make it harder for trespassers to break in.

Q: What should I try to find when picking a double glazing installer?
- Search for a reputable installer with a great performance history. Examine for accreditations such as FENSA (Fenestration Self-Assessment Scheme) or BFRC (British Fenestration Rating Council) to make sure that the installer meets industry requirements. Read reviews and request for referrals to get a concept of their work quality.
